热门文章 | 热门软件| 热门源码 | 热门电影 | 知识库 | 联系我们
软件 源码 教程 影视 健康 招聘
  HTML | JavaScript | ASP | PHP | JSP | NET | VB | VC | VF | Windows | Linux | Mysql | Mssql | Oracle | Struts 
当前位置: 创世纪计算机资源网 -> 文章频道 ->flash 
站内搜索:
flash控件Datagrid之字段排序
作者:adobe 来源:帮助文档 整理日期:2007-10-8

DataGridColumn.sortOnHeaderRelease

可用性

Flash Player 6 (6.0.79.0)。

版本

Flash MX Professional 2004。

用法

myDataGrid.getColumnAt(index).sortOnHeaderRelease

说明

属性;一个布尔值,它指示在用户单击列标题时是 (true) 否 (false) 自动对列进行排序。只有在 DataGridColumn.sortable 设置为 true 时,此属性才能设置为 true。如果 DataGridColumn.sortOnHeaderRelease 设置为 false,您可以捕获 headerRelease 事件并执行自己的排序。默认值为 true

小心

如果 DataGrid 直接绑定到 WebServiceConnector 组件或 XMLConnector 组件,则 DataGrid 不可编辑也不可排序。如果要使网格可编辑或可排序,则必须将 DataGrid 组件绑定到 DataSet 组件,并将 DataSet 组件绑定到 WebServiceConnector 组件或 XMLConnector 组件。有关更多信息,请参见"使用 Flash"中的数据集成(仅限 Flash Professional)。

示例

以下示例禁止对第二列进行排序:

// 设置网格属性。
my_dg.setSize(150, 100);

// 设置范例数据。
my_dg.addItem({name:"Clark", score:3135});
my_dg.addItem({name:"Bruce", score:403});
my_dg.addItem({name:"Peter", score:25});

// 不允许通过单击列标题对第二列进行排序。
my_dg.getColumnAt(1).sortOnHeaderRelease = false;
相关文章